Azure.ResourceManager.DurableTask (.NET)
Provisionner des planificateurs de tâches durables Azure avec .NET
Gérez efficacement les ressources du planificateur de tâches durables Azure en utilisant le SDK Azure Resource Manager. Cette compétence vous guide pour créer des planificateurs, des hubs de tâches et des politiques de rétention avec une authentification appropriée et les meilleures pratiques.
تنزيل ZIP المهارة
رفع في Claude
اذهب إلى Settings → Capabilities → Skills → Upload skill
فعّل وابدأ الاستخدام
اختبرها
استخدام "Azure.ResourceManager.DurableTask (.NET)". Créer un planificateur de tâches durables nommé 'production-scheduler' dans East US avec le SKU Dedicated
النتيجة المتوقعة:
Planificateur de tâches durables 'production-scheduler' créé avec succès dans East US avec le SKU Dedicated (1 instance). Point de terminaison : https://production-scheduler.eastus.durabletask.azure.com/
استخدام "Azure.ResourceManager.DurableTask (.NET)". Lister tous les planificateurs dans l'abonnement et afficher leur statut
النتيجة المتوقعة:
3 planificateurs trouvés : production-scheduler (Dedicated, En cours d'exécution), dev-scheduler (Consumption, En cours d'exécution), test-scheduler (Dedicated, Arrêté)
التدقيق الأمني
آمنDocumentation-only skill with no executable code. Static analysis scanned 0 files and detected 0 security issues. The skill provides reference documentation for Azure Resource Manager SDK usage for Durable Task Scheduler management. No prompt injection attempts or malicious patterns detected.
درجة الجودة
ماذا يمكنك بناءه
Ingénieur DevOps provisionnant l'infrastructure
Automatiser la création de ressources de planificateur de tâches durables dans le cadre des pipelines de déploiement d'infrastructure
Développeur d'applications configurant des orchestrations
Provisionner les ressources Azure requises avant de déployer le code d'orchestration en production
Architecte Cloud concevant des solutions
Évaluer et configurer les options de planificateur de tâches durables pour les solutions de workflow d'entreprise
جرّب هذه الموجهات
Aidez-moi à créer un planificateur de tâches durables dans mon abonnement Azure en utilisant le SDK Azure.ResourceManager.DurableTask. J'ai mon ID d'abonnement et mon groupe de ressources prêts.
Montrez-moi comment lister tous les planificateurs de tâches durables dans mon abonnement Azure et afficher leurs propriétés.
Je dois créer un planificateur de tâches durables avec des restrictions de liste d'autorisation IP pour la sécurité de production. Montrez-moi le code complet avec une gestion d'erreurs appropriée.
Créez un exemple complet qui provisionne un planificateur de tâches durables avec le SKU Dedicated, crée un hub de tâches, configure une politique de rétention, et inclut du code de nettoyage pour la suppression des ressources.
أفضل الممارسات
- Utiliser DefaultAzureCredential pour l'authentification afin de prendre en charge plusieurs types d'identifiants, y compris l'identité managée
- Toujours utiliser WaitUntil.Completed pour les opérations qui doivent se terminer avant que les actions dépendantes ne se poursuivent
- Supprimer les hubs de tâches avant de supprimer leurs planificateurs parents pour éviter les conflits de ressources
تجنب
- Ne pas coder en dur les identifiants ou les chaînes de connexion dans le code source
- Éviter d'utiliser WaitUntil.Started sans implémenter une logique d'interrogation appropriée
- Ne pas ignorer la gestion d'erreurs pour RequestFailedException lors de l'appel aux API ARM